I have magic1.dll (together with the two other information the docs specified) in C:WindowsSystem32 so I'm not certain what The difficulty is. I'd value any assistance or workarounds.
The basic instance could be the library-offered ::operator new and ::operator delete implementations. We regularly call them "overloadable" in everyday language, while formally These are replaceable
Nonetheless, SO should be capable of stand by itself even though the rest of the World-wide-web disappears! By all signifies hyperlink to a different supply, but I choose to put some meat in The solution as well.
Listed here "2" is a "magic" selection, and that is factored out to your symbolic frequent default_padding in the context on the GUI UX of "my plan" in an effort to allow it to be use as default_padding rapidly recognized inside the increased context in the enclosing code.
We have two eventualities for our magic standard values. Only the second is of Major great importance for programmers and code:
mock magic procedures but you have to define them. MagicMock has "default implementations of many of the magic procedures.".
user2052437user2052437 17311 gold badge11 silver badge88 bronze badges 8 Stupid issue, have you restarted the command prompt Once you've added the DLL's to the PATH and Before you decide to executed the script? (foolish issue, since you naturally know your way all-around ctypes)
0 is likewise designed into your X86 instructions to 'move strings proficiently'. Saves lots of microseconds.
Kinds could be specified and an affiliated plan to present the kind. Then everywhere the type is utilised every one of the settings routinely kick in. I like especially that one can compose This system and five months later change the title of a variable and it really is carried all over the application.
Look at stand-alone manifest constant essential values as part copyright of your code text. Check with Every single concern little by little and thoughtfully about Each and every instance of such a worth. Look at the power of the reply.
. ten. Just the variety with no words leaves us in a spot of possibly great confusion and probably with glitches inside our game if distinct portions of the sport have dependencies on what that range of figures suggests to various functions like attack_elves or seek_magic_healing_potion.
The middle column is operate indefinitely right up until you split the cycle. It is sort of a do Until eventually loop. If You must do an item when you finally place it into this infinite loop and end it immediately after one particular cycle.
. The normal library is permitted to rely on them, however , you and I usually are not. So when you were going to put in writing your own STL implementation, you would have to make some minimal improvements, but that's not as a result of any magic, merely a way to stay away from name clashes among the typical library and person code. Share Improve this reply Observe
In programming, a "magic quantity" is a value that ought to be supplied a symbolic title, but was alternatively slipped to the code as being a literal, generally in more than one location.